What to Look for in a Bathroom Shelf

Measure Your Space First

Bathroom shelves under $150 come in specific dimensions that can't be modified. Measure floor space, wall width, and ceiling height before ordering. Over-toilet units need at least 35 inches of clearance above the tank; freestanding towers require stable floor space away from high-traffic areas.

Weight Capacity Matters

Cheap shelves buckle under heavy towels and toiletries. Look for at least 50 pounds per shelf for general use; 100+ pounds for linen storage. Wire shelving distributes weight better than solid shelves, reducing sag over time. Always check manufacturer specs and user reviews for real-world capacity tests.

Material Durability in Humidity

Bathrooms expose shelves to constant moisture and temperature swings. Rust-resistant steel or powder-coated metal outlasts chrome in humidity. Bamboo offers natural water resistance but requires sealing. Avoid untreated wood that warps and particle board that swells when wet.

Installation Type Determines Placement

Freestanding units require no installation but consume floor space. Wall-mounted shelves need stud-finding and drilling but free up floor area. Adhesive mounts work for lightweight items under 15 pounds. Tension-mounted poles fit floor-to-ceiling applications without drilling.

Adjustability Equals Versatility

Fixed-shelf units limit storage options. Adjustable shelves every 1-2 inches accommodate tall bottles, stacked towels, and small appliances. Look for easy-adjust systems without tools. Over-toilet units with adjustable feet level on uneven floors, preventing wobble.

Style Should Match Your Decor

Industrial steel suits modern and minimalist bathrooms. Bamboo and wood add warmth to farmhouse or rustic themes. Glass shelves create airy, spa-like aesthetics. Black finishes hide water spots better than chrome or white. Consider existing fixtures and hardware when selecting finishes.

What weight capacity do I need for bathroom shelves?
Standard toiletries require 15-25 lbs per shelf. For towel storage, aim for 50+ lbs per shelf. Linen closets need 100+ lbs capacity. The Amazon Basics unit's 150 lbs per shelf handles any bathroom storage scenario with room to spare.
Are adhesive shelves reliable in humid bathrooms?
Quality adhesive shelves support 10-15 pounds when properly installed on clean, non-porous surfaces like tile or glass. Avoid painted drywall in humid areas. For heavy items, always choose mechanical mounting over adhesive.
What's the best material for bathroom shelf durability?
Powder-coated steel offers the best moisture resistance and weight capacity. Stainless steel resists rust but shows water spots. Bamboo provides natural water resistance with warmer aesthetics. Chrome-plated steel can peel and rust in high humidity.
Can I install floating shelves without drilling?
No reliable floating shelf system exists without drilling. Adhesive options only work for lightweight caddies, not true floating shelves. For damage-free installation, consider tension-mounted poles or freestanding units that require zero wall attachment.
Over-toilet vs. freestanding: which is better?
Over-toilet units maximize wasted vertical space but require precise measurements. Freestanding towers offer placement flexibility and higher weight capacity. Choose based on your bathroom layout and whether you need to move the unit frequently.
